KUWTK: How Kim & Kanye Are Finding Balance With Co-Parenting

Kanye West appears to be in a better place with Keeping Up With the Kardashians star Kim Kardashian amid their divorce, and we're here to talk about how they are balancing their parental responsibilities. In recent weeks, the two have been seen co-parenting their children together and supporting each other in different ways. The two superstars have had one of the most amicable splits in Hollywood despite Kim filing for divorce earlier this year. Though Kanye has fueled dating rumors with Irina Shayk, insiders say that Kim and Kanye will always support each other no matter what.
Fans were happy to see Kim attend Kanye's listening party in Atlanta with their four kids. Not only was she present, but she and Kanye donned fits with matching colors that appeared to be a nod towards their solidarity. It was only a few months ago when sources claimed that Kanye and Kim weren't on speaking terms, with the Yeezy founder reportedly changing his numbers so that Kim could only contact him through his security. It looks like time heals all wounds and the former couple has gotten to a better space amid their ongoing divorce.
Sources say that while Kim and Kanye work to finalize the dissolution of their marriage, the two billionaires are "civil and talk quite often" despite what fans might think. “Sharing moments as a family is still very much important to Kim and Kanye,” an insider told Hollywood Life. Many were surprised to see Kim seated front and center with their kids and her sister Khloé Kardashian at Kanye's listening party for his highly-anticipated album, "Donda." Her attendance came a few weeks after source reports revealed Kanye's involvement with Kim's KKW Beauty relaunch. “When it comes to their work, they want to be front and center with their support and they want to do it as a family because that is what it’s all about," the source added.

While their matching outfits at the listening party had many under the impression that there could be signs of reconciliation, insiders say that part of their relationship is done with. "Their romance is over, but their co-parenting is forever," the source said. "That is end all be all for both of them.” With them sharing four young children together, they will continue to spend time together raising their children. Onlookers will have to get comfortable with seeing Kim and Kanye together. It's something that will happen “again and again and it’s all for the benefit of all their kids,” the source explained, adding, “Kim doesn’t want to mess that up whatsoever.” The Kar-Jenners are known for their deep family values, whether the parents are together or not.
